Event ID 1020 from server trying to relay through Exchange
I have a server that serves as a document workflow process. It uses Exchange as its SMTP server, and all worked when we were on Exchange 2010. Now, with Exchange 2013, it no long can send emails. The client side error makes it sound like
it's trying to send out too many emails at a time and I need to bump up some settings. On the server side it seems like it's a permissions issue.
On the client end, they get the error:
Error occurred while sending mail. Detail: Service not available, closing transmission channel. The server response was: 4.3.2 The maximum number of concurrent connections has exceeded a limit, closing transmission channel.
One the Exchange 2013 side I see this error each time:
Event ID 1020 MSExchangeFrontEndTransport
The account 'NT AUTHORITY\ANONYMOUS LOGON' provided valid credentials, but is not authorized to use the server; failing authentication.
Hi ,
On exchange 2013 either you would have the default receive connector or custom receive connector to accept the emails from the server that serves as a document workflow process.
On that receive connector , please check the parameters "MaxInboundConnectionPerSource & MaxInboundConnection & MaxInboundConnectionPercentagePerSource & ConnectionTimeout & ConnectionInactivityTimeout " and for a testing purpose ,
please change the values as per your requirement.
Better way is to have the separate receive connector for accepting emails from the application server instead of doing the changes on the default receive connector.
On my side i strongly suspecting the error occurred on your side is because of minimal value on the parameter " MaxInboundConnectionPerSource" in receive connector .Anyhow the best practice is to check all the parameter and do the changes on the
receive connector which you have utilized to receive emails from the application server.
Reference Link for the above parameters: http://technet.microsoft.com/en-in/library/bb125140(v=exchg.150).aspx
Note : I hope you are not relaying emails to the users in outside world through exchange server from the server which doing the document workflow process.
I case if would like to do that we need to assign some permissions on the newly created or custom receive connector to achieve your scenario.Because by default exchange will not be in open relay.

Once I have downloaded email on my iPad the same is not downloaded on my laptop. Have tried all settings including choosing the setting DELETE FROM SERVER:NEVER and REMOVE FROM SERVER:NEVER
Hey rbrylawski, just wanted to let you know that my ipad email problems have been solved. Called Apple Sup in OZ, I'm in NZ. Daniel Barber was the support tech from heaven!! I was about to return the ipad but solving this issue reset my faith in phone support.....perhaps until I call a differnet companys phone support eh? Anyhow, for reference the fix is below. My accounts are all POP not IMAP, and the primary smtp server setting had defaulted to have SSL switched on and the port was set to 5XX (something, cant remember). Anyhow, SSL was switched off and the port was swithced to 25. VOILÀ!! Settings/Mail, contacts, calendars/My POP mail account/smtp/primary server/ >>> server on, no username and password, use SSL off, no authentication, Server Port 25 Thanks for having a crack at it.
